#319596 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#319596 is composed of 19.2% red, 58.4%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 0.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 180.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 39%. #319596 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#002b2d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#319596 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#319596 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#319596 has RGB values of R:49, G:149,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 3249558.

Shades and Tints of #319596
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#319596
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6868 is the less saturated color, while #03c2c4 is the most saturated one.
